Compensation Analyst III managing administration of salary compensation and job evaluations for GEICO. Developing reports and supporting corporate function needs with strategic compensation planning.
Responsibilities
Manage the administration of base salary compensation, job evaluations, market pricing, and salary structure.
Support the administration of year-end compensation.
Develop and present summary reports of job analysis and compensation analysis information.
Prepare survey submissions and gather data from market-based compensation surveys; use spreadsheet and data analysis techniques to assess results and market trends.
Support Compensation Business Partner for corporate functions to serve the business for job evaluations, external candidate offers, salary structure reviews, and other business needs.
Act as project planner for scheduled and ad hoc initiatives such as salary schedule reviews.
Requirements
7+ years related experience in compensation analysis.
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Human Resources, Mathematics, Finance, or related field.
Proficient in Excel.
Experience with Workday HCM and Advanced Compensation preferred.
